Question - Kylie Computers is a small local business that provides a wide range of computer hardware and builds custom computer systems for clients using self-developed technology. The company is approached by an outside supplier of graphics cards that offers to sell finished graphics cards to Kylie Computers for $65 per unit. The management team gathers the relevant internal cost data and determines that it can manufacture graphics cards with the following costs:

Direct Materials $40 per unit

Direct Labor $10 per unit

Variable manufacturing overhead $3 per unit

Factory vice president compensation $200,000

Factory property taxes, insurance, etc. $80,000

Salaries for production supervisors (3 x $50,000) $150,000

Salaries for factory maintenance workers (5 x $25,000) $125,000

If Kylie outsources the production of the graphics cards, the company will no longer need two of the three production supervisors and three of the five maintenance workers. These five people will be either fired or reassigned to other tasks within the company.

1. What is total variable cost per unit?

2. What is the total avoidable fixed cost if Kylie decides to outsource production?

3. What is the total cost of buying from the outside supplier if Kylie produces 15,000 units?

4. What is the difference in total cost between outsourcing and manufacturing if Kylie plans to produce 10,000 units?

5. What is the difference in total cost between outsourcing and manufacturing if Kylie plans to produce 20,000 units?
